Catalog description

Continuing the study of commutative Noetherian rings and their modules from Commutative Algebra I, this course is designed to cover the topics after which one could do research in commutative algebra and follow most talks at a standard conference or special session in the field. Topics include regular sequences, Cohen-Macaulay rings, Gorenstein rings, regular local rings, complete local rings, injective dimension, graded rings and modules, the Koszul complex, the canonical module, and local cohomology. Offered by Mathematics . May not be repeated for credit.
